Sibilant Spirit puts a 4/4 flying body on the board and draws your opponents cards — that political liability is the entire cost of the effect. A 6-mana 4/4 flier is below rate by itself, and handing card advantage to opponents is a real downside that only pays off in decks built to weaponize it.

In Commander, Sibilant Spirit only belongs in decks that punish card draws — Nekusar, the Mindrazer, Niv-Mizzet, Parun, or similar group-draw strategies where the drawback is the whole point. Outside that narrow shell, the card is a political liability that accelerates opponents for free. In Legacy and Vintage, a 6-mana 4/4 flier with a symmetrical downside has never been competitive and sees no meaningful play. Oathbreaker is the one format where a tightly focused signature spell or commander could make Sibilant Spirit's triggered draws matter, but the mana cost is still a hard sell at that scale.

At $0.25, Sibilant Spirit is deep bulk — the price reflects how rarely it gets played outside of very specific casual builds. It holds that floor easily since casual group-draw players do pick it up, but there's no pressure driving it higher.
